Abstract

The utility model belongs to the technical field of casting machines and particularly relates to an structure improvement of polyurethane elastomer casting machines, which comprises a controller, a charging bucket and a warmer which are connected with the controller, a stirrer connected with a material delivery pipe of the charging bucket and a molding die, wherein the lower portion of the charging bucket is provided with a heat-insulating box which covers the lower equipment of the charging bucket, the outer surface of a stirrer shell is covered by an outer sleeve which is used for charging cooling medium, the side wall of the molding die is provided with an opening and hinged with a side cover, and the material delivery pipe is a thin plastic pipe without a heating device. Structure improvement of polyurethane elastomer casting machines has the advantages that the heat-insulating and energysaving effects are remarkable, the cooling time of raw materials in the stirrer is reduced, the production efficiency is enhanced, the appearances of products is aesthetic and the intensities of the products is uniform, moreover, the material delivery pipe uses the thin plastic pipe, thus the raw materials are saved, the waste is reduced, the production benefits of companies are improved, and the structure improvement of polyurethane elastomer casting machines is suitable to be applied to the polyurethane elastomer casting machines of the same type.

Background technology
At present, the structure of polyurethane elastomer casting machine, the agitator and the mould that generally comprise controller, two batch cans that are connected with controller and warmer, are connected with the conveying pipeline of batch can: described batch can generally all is provided with interlayer, with the warmer outside the batch can interlayer is heated, so that the raw material in the batch can is heated to the temperature that needs, its weak point is: the one, and the pipeline of batch can bottom, accessory heat insulation effect are poor, temperature is scattered and disappeared fast, need warmer to provide heat energy to heat in large quantities, waste heat energy; The 2nd, the pipeline of batch can and batch can bottom thereof, the variations in temperature of equipment are big, need control continually for specific design temperature, controller are caused over-burden; Described mould generally comprises upper die and lower die, matched moulds behind the resin that injection mixes in counterdie, treat die sinking behind its foamed solidification, its weak point is: have bubble in the process of upper and lower mould matched moulds and be retained in the mould, cause the upper surface or the lower surface of the finished product of foaming that pore is arranged, the one, influence the attractive in appearance of product, the 2nd, influence the intensity of product; Described agitator generally is not provided with cooling device, the material temperature that transports from batch can generally remains on about 90 ℃, under this temperature, will foam under the situation that two kinds of raw materials also do not mix, must wait for being cooled to just can stir after the suitable temperature (about about 50 ℃), like this, both bad control, also the stand-by period long, influence production efficiency; In addition, used conveying pipeline: the one, be provided with heat-insulation layer, equipment cost is improved, be difficult for observing inner raw material mobility status; The 2nd, caliber is thick, after shut-down or having a power failure, can keep somewhere more raw material in the pipeline, causes the raising of wastage of material and production cost.
